# Per-user option to left-pad trace IDs with zeros to 32 hex characters in search API responses.
|
||||
# When enabled, trace IDs like "8efff798038103d269b633813fc703" will be returned as
|
||||
# "008efff798038103d269b633813fc703" to comply with the OpenTelemetry and W3C Trace Context specifications.
|
||||
[left_pad_trace_ids: <bool> | default = false]

// traceIDPadding is a string of 32 zeros used for left-padding trace IDs.
|
||||
const traceIDPadding = "00000000000000000000000000000000"
|
||||
|
||||
// PadTraceIDString left-pads a trace ID hex string to 32 characters with zeros.
|
||||
// This produces W3C/OpenTelemetry compliant 32-character lowercase hex trace IDs.
|
||||
func PadTraceIDString(id string) string {
|
||||
if len(id) >= 32 {
|
||||
return id
|
||||
}
|
||||
return traceIDPadding[:32-len(id)] + id
|
||||
}
